Dead Key Fob Batteries

Battery problems can cause your key fob to stop unlocking your car or turning your engine on as it did previously. Fobs aren't built to last forever, and they could need a new one every three or four years. It's important to know the kind of batteries your fob is using, so you can replace them yourself if necessary.

Typically, the batteries in your keyfob will come with an identification label that identifies the type of battery inside. It may also say something about the size of the battery, for instance CR2025 or CR2032 (depending on your vehicle). You can use a voltmeter check the voltage or replace it with a brand new battery.

After the battery has had time to charge, you may notice that your key fob starts to work again. If that doesn't work you might need to reprogramme your key fob in order for your car to recognize it again. This is a simple procedure that can be completed in just a few steps.

First place the key into your ignition and switch it to the accessory position. Then, press a button on the fob to secure it. The chime will sound in the car, signalling that it is ready to use again. If you do not hear anything after a second attempt it could be because the key fob isn't able to communicate with the receiver in your car, which is another issue.

It may be damaged If your key fob does not function after reprogramming and changing the batteries. This is usually the situation if your device has been physically damaged for example, like when it was stepped on or dropped in a pool of water. Damage could include cracks on the circuit board, teeny electronic components that aren't connected to the circuit board correctly, buttons that aren't working or loose in any way, or bent or oxidized battery connectors. A skilled and reputable auto repair service can usually solve this issue by opening the fob, removing the battery for a closer inspection, and then repairing or replacing any component that has been damaged.

Key Fob Issues

Newer key fobs transmit an electronic signal whenever the buttons on the key fob are activated. This is distinct from older key fobs that relied on physical keys to open the doors and start the car. If the signal is not received or if the chip is defective, then your remote will not work. Fortunately, the majority of key fob problems are simple to fix, and typically don't require professional help.

Key fobs, as with any other battery-powered device, get worn out over time. In some cases, the simple replacement of the batteries inside the remote will restore the fob's ability to lock and unlock the car doors or start the engine (depending on the type of the vehicle).

The key fob may not function even after replacing its batteries due to interference in the radio signal. This can be caused when other electronic devices, such as GPS devices and mobile key fob repair phones are in close proximity to the fob. It could also be caused by objects made of metal that interfere with radio frequency signals. Attempting to move the key fob closer to the car or away from other devices will help resolve this issue.

Another common problem is that the battery contact terminals on the fob or buttons are broken or stuck. The buttons on key fobs are often damaged or worn out because they're not designed to be tough and get a lot use. In certain instances the simple act of cleaning or adjusting buttons can resolve this issue.

If the issue continues, you should contact a car dealership or locksmith. They'll have access to authentic parts and will have expertise on the keyless entry system of the specific model of your vehicle and make. Examining the remote key fob can help determine the cause of the malfunction. They can give you suggestions for the most cost-effective and convenient alternatives.
